A water tower will be built to store water produced for needed fire flow. The design of the water tank will be cylindrical with a bottom radius of 50 ft. The service area has 20 one-story warehouses; all warehouses are noncombustible structures, and their average floor area is 0.50 acre. The sum of exposure and communication factors is 0.60 for each warehouse. What will be the needed fire flow (in GPM)? What will be the volume of water (in m3) that needs to be produced and stored in the water tank? What will be the gage pressure (in psi) at the bottom of the water tank?
